ASHEBORO - Barbara Ann Pany, 57, of Farmer, NC left this world Friday, August 14, 2020 with her husband and daughter by her side. She fought a courageous battle against cancer and never complained, as she always had a smile on her face. Born in Holland, Michigan, she was the most beautiful tiny baby girl born and was a genuine friend to anyone she met. She graduated from Randleman High School and Asheboro Business College with dreams to travel the world as a flight attendant. She was the owner of Sunshine Pets store in Randleman, NC which was another dream of hers that she made come true. She spent most of her time in Michigan and North Carolina. In 1982, she met her husband and they shared many adventures during their 37 years marriage including many memories made in Germany spending time with their family. In 1990, her baby girl Chelsey was born who was her most precious gift in life! Barbara loved her family and friends, never met an animal she didn't love, and enjoyed her sweet tea and romance novels. Although we will miss her dearly, we know Barbara is healed and reunited with those that were waiting to meet her in Heaven.
